#5f1409 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5f1409 is composed of 37.3% red, 7.8%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.9% magenta, 90.5% yellow and 62.7% black. It has a hue angle of 7.7 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 20.4%. #5f1409 color hex could be obtained by blending #be2812 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

#5f1409 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5f1409 has RGB values of R:95, G:20,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.91,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 6231049.
